SSA (Ro) ELISA Test kit Intended Use
SSA (Ro) ELISA Kit is intended for the detection and semi-quantitation of IgG, A, M antibodies to SSA (Ro) in human sera. The results of this assay are to be used as an aid to the diagnosis of autoimmune disease.

Method Principle
This Diagnostic Automation/ Cortez Diagnostics Inc. Human SSA (Ro) ELISA Kit is an Enzyme-Linked Immunosorbent Assay to detect IgG, IgA, and IgM antibodies to SSA (Ro) antigens. Purified SSA (Ro) antigens are attached to a solid phase microplate wells. When antigens bound to the solid phase are brought into contact with a patient serum, antigen specific antibody, if present, will bind to the antigen on the solid phase forming antigen antibody complexes. Background Information
Immunoassays for auto antibodies are useful for diagnostic and prognostic evaluations of autoimmune disease. SSA (also named Ro) antigen consists of protein complexed with RNA. Approximately 60% of patients with Sjogren syndrome and 35% of SLE patients have antibodies to SSA. SLE patients with SSA (Ro) antibodies alone (negative La/SSB) have a greater chance of developing nephritis.
